Palliative therapy: The other primary goal of chemotherapy with lung cancer is palliative. Palliative, or supportive, care is meant to relieve symptoms and improve a person's quality of life. 1 If it's been determined that cancer cannot be cured, chemotherapy may still be beneficial to shrink tumor size enough to alleviate the physical symptoms of cancer and to slow the progress of cancer enough to extend life. Chemotherapy can be used to treat lung cancer in several ways: Aim to cure early stage or locally advanced inoperable lung cancer in combination with radiotherapy (chemoradiotherapy) Attempt to shrink the tumour before surgery or radiotherapy (neo-adjuvant chemotherapy) Extend length of life when a cure is not possible (palliative chemotherapy) It has a role in early, medically inoperable, and locally advanced unresectable non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C), where some patients are cured, in the palliation of advanced lung cancer of all types, and . Palliative chemotherapy is treatment that is given in the non-curative setting to optimize symptom control, improve or maintain QoL and, ideally, to also improve survival.
